INTRODUCTION:
Adam Tech right angle PCB SCSI II / III connectors are a popular
high density interface for many I/O applications requiring a miniature
connector. Offered in 20, 26, 28, 40, 50, 68, 80, 100 and 120
positions they are a good choice for high density compact
applications. They feature a flat leaf and fork contact design and a
one touch, locking receptacle/plug combination. These connectors
are manufactured with precision stamped contacts offering a choice
of contact plating and a wide selection of mating and mounting
options. They are ideal for most compact electronic applications.
FEATURES:
Conforms to SCSI II standards
One touch Locking Receptacle and Plug
Blade contact with Blanked terminal
Industry standard compatibility
Durable metal shell design
Precision formed contacts
Variety of Mating and mounting options
MATING CONNECTORS:
Adam Tech SCSI II / III connectors and all industry standard
SCSI II / III connectors.
SPECIFICATIONS:
Material:
Standard insulator: PBT, Glass filled, rated UL94V-0
Optional Hi-Temp insulator: Nylon 6T UL94V-0
Insulator Color: Black
Contacts: Phosphor Bronze
Metal backshell: Zinc, Nickel Plated
Contact Plating:
Gold Flash over nickel underplate on mating area, Tin over
Copper underplate on tails
Electrical:
Operating Voltage: 250V AC
Current Rating: 1 Amp max.
Contact Resistance: 35 mΩ max. initial
Insulation Resistance: 500 MΩ min.
Dielectric Withstanding Voltage: 500V AC for 1 minute
Mechanical:
Insertion force: 5.3 oz max.
Withdrawal force: 1.0 oz min.
Durability: 100 cycles
Temperature Rating:
Operating Temperature: -55°C to +105°C
Soldering proces temperature:
Standard insulator: 235°C
Hi-Temp insulator: 260°C
PACKAGING:
Anti-ESD plastic trays
APPROVALS AND CERTIFICATIONS:
UL Recognized File No. E224053
CSA Certified File No. LR1578596
